Bear Song (Tune: Sippin Cider)

The other day
I saw a bear
Out in the woods
A-way out there

He looked at me
I looked at him
He sized up me
I sized up him

He said to me
Why don’t you run?
I see you ain’t
Got any gun.

I said to him,
“That’s a good idea!”
I said to my feet,
“Get out-a here!”

And so I ran
Away from there.
But right behind
Me was that bear.

Ahead of me
I saw a tree
A great big tree
Oh Lordy me!

The lowest branch
Was ten feet up
I’d have to jump
And trust my luck

And so I jumped
Into the air
But I missed that branch
A-way up there

Now don’t you fret
And don’t you frown
Cus’ I caught that branch
A-way up there

That is the end
There ain’t no more
Unless I meet
That bear once more
